[Bug 1031918] [NEW] Automated actions stop working after server restart in crm_helpdesk

 

Public bug reported:

Environment:
Ubuntu 12.04 LTS
Openerp 6.1 (Server RevNo: 4250 | Addons RevNo: 6897)
Fresh install
Installed Modules:

- CRM
- CRM Helpdesk
- Automated Rules (base_action_rule)

Configured email gateway to create a new helpdesk object
Configured automated action to set the state to 'In Progress'

Every email received through that gateway creates a helpdesk object and
the automated action sets it to In Progress (tried several, 3-4)

Upon server restart (ctrl+c, ./openerp-server -c config-file.conf)

Objects get created but the automatic action does not fire anymore and
it was left untouched

And on this particular video that i've attached it didn't even set the
responsable user to Administrator (in the previous examples it did)
which only leads me to the conclusion that there are several bugs in the
helpdesk module...
